安卓小游戏教程,从入门到实战

小编

你有没有想过,手机里那些小小的游戏,竟然能让人如此着迷?没错,说的就是安卓小游戏!今天,我就要带你走进这个奇妙的世界,手把手教你如何制作一款属于自己的安卓小游戏。准备好了吗?让我们一起来开启这段有趣的旅程吧!

一、初识安卓小游戏

安卓小游戏教程,从入门到实战(图1)

安卓小游戏,顾名思义,就是运行在安卓系统上的小游戏。它们体积小巧,操作简单,非常适合在碎片化时间里消遣。而且,制作安卓小游戏并不像你想的那么难,只要掌握了一些基础知识和技巧,你也可以成为游戏开发者哦!

二、制作安卓小游戏的准备工作

安卓小游戏教程,从入门到实战(图2)

在开始制作安卓小游戏之前,你需要准备以下几样东西:

1. 开发环境:Android Studio是谷歌官方推出的Android开发工具,功能强大,非常适合初学者使用。

2. 编程语言:安卓游戏开发主要使用Java或Kotlin语言,你可以根据自己的喜好选择一种。

3. 游戏素材:包括游戏背景、角色、音效等,这些素材可以通过网络下载或者自己制作。

三、安卓小游戏开发教程

安卓小游戏教程,从入门到实战(图3)

1. 创建项目:打开Android Studio,点击“Start a new Android Studio project”,选择“Empty Activity”模板,然后填写项目名称、保存位置等信息。

2. 设计界面:在布局文件(如activity_main.xml)中,使用各种控件(如Button、ImageView等)来设计游戏界面。

3. 编写代码:在MainActivity.java(或MainActivity.kt)文件中,编写游戏逻辑代码。例如,你可以使用Timer类来实现游戏计时功能,使用SharedPreferences类来保存游戏数据等。

4. 添加素材:将游戏素材导入项目中,并在代码中调用它们。例如,你可以使用ImageView控件来显示游戏背景和角色。

5. 测试游戏:在Android Studio中运行游戏,检查游戏是否正常运行。如果发现问题,及时修改代码。

四、实战案例:制作一个简单的贪吃蛇游戏

1. 设计界面:在activity_main.xml中,使用LinearLayout和RelativeLayout布局,添加一个全屏的ImageView作为游戏区域,以及两个Button作为开始和结束游戏按钮。

2. 编写代码:在MainActivity.java中,定义一个Snake类来表示蛇,一个Food类来表示食物,以及一个GameView类来绘制游戏界面和更新游戏状态。

3. 添加素材:将蛇和食物的图片导入项目中,并在GameView中使用ImageView控件来显示它们。

4. 测试游戏:运行游戏,尝试控制蛇吃食物,观察游戏是否正常运行。

五、发布你的安卓小游戏

1. 生成APK文件:在Android Studio中,点击“Build”菜单,选择“Generate Signed APK”,然后按照提示生成APK文件。

2. 上传到应用市场:将生成的APK文件上传到应用市场,如华为应用市场、小米应用商店等。

怎么样,是不是觉得制作安卓小游戏并没有想象中那么难呢?只要你掌握了基础知识和技巧,就可以轻松制作出属于自己的游戏。快来试试吧,相信你一定会爱上这个充满创造力的世界!